    Why don't you want to wear polo shirts? They're quite youthful and suitable for casual wear. Also, for a little more versatility, there are some very nice short-sleeved button-down shirts for a more classic, sophisticated look. There are decent articles of clothing sold at ExpressMen, The Gap, Banana Republic and Macy's. Depending on the time of year, there are some great sales at most of those establishments(Banana tends to be a bit more expensive) and one can usually find clothing that is reasonably priced.
